Belle Haven Investments, L.P. is an SEC-registered investment adviser in Rye Brook, NY, registered since 2006. The firm manages approximately $23.3 billion in assets. It employs 47 staff and 40 investment advisers.

What investment strategy does Belle Haven Investments follow?
Belle Haven focuses exclusively on fixed income, specifically municipal bonds and investment-grade corporate credit. The firm targets essential-service infrastructure credits such as utilities, transportation, and healthcare, and typically holds bonds to maturity. It avoids equities, commodities, and complex structured products.
